Lloyds bins paper statements

Lloyds TSB has launched an improved Internet service, allowing customers to view and search bank statements electronically.

The bank is giving customers the option to stop receiving printed statements in an environmentally friendly effort. Lloyds will also dedicate 10,000 trees with the help of climate control company Future Forests to the first customers who sign up for this service.

"By giving our customers the choice to stop receiving paper statements and by dedicating trees through Future Forests, we hope we can give something back to the environment," said Matthew Timms, director of Internet banking.

Entries dating back to July 2002 will be searchable. Specific paper statements can be ordered free of charge.

"The convenience of online banking is an obvious draw for millions of customers who want to be able to manage their money when and where they choose," Mr Timms said.
